How much do remote civil eng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 4,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ote civil engineer in the United States is $82,674.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$67,500.00 and $98,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a Remote Civil Engineer job?

A Remote Civil Engineer is a professional who designs, develops, and oversees construction projects while working from a remote location. They use digital tools like CAD software, project management platforms, and video conferencing to collaborate with teams and clients. This role may involve tasks such as site planning, structural analysis, and coordinating with contractors. Remote Civil Engineers often work in industries like infrastructure, transportation, and environmental engineering. Strong communication skills and the ability to work independently are essential for success in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Remote Civil Engineer position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Civil Engineer, you need a solid foundation in civil engineering principles, proficiency in design and analysis, and an accredited engineering degree, often with a Professional Engineer (PE) license. Familiarity with technical tools such as AutoCAD, Civil 3D, Revit, and project management software is typically required. Strong communication, time management, and problem-solving skills are essential for collaborating remotely and meeting project deadlines. These abilities ensure the delivery of accurate, efficient, and compliant engineering solutions while working effectively in virtual or distributed teams.

What are some common challenges faced by remote civil engineers and how can they be addressed?

Remote civil engineers often face challenges such as coordinating across multiple time zones, maintaining clear communication with clients and onsite teams, and managing project documents and revisions efficiently. To overcome these obstacles, most companies provide robust collaboration tools, regular virtual meetings, and cloud-based document management systems to streamline workflow. Proactively communicating and setting clear expectations with team members helps ensure projects stay on track. By embracing digital communication platforms and staying organized, remote civil engineers can successfully deliver high-quality work from any location.
